Dreamcatcher

Her house, lone secluded structure,
Surrounded by hoards of prickly bush, 
A single rose in bloom.

Voices, chants, shrill and low,
Do this, do that, or you have to go.
A pensive loner among bodies so cold.

A dreamcatcher hanging on her door, 
Protect her, guide her, 
Life's journey to Mount Doom, 
Her dreams, flutter past her eyes.

Breakaway, oh let her!
Her soul too pure for this crazy breed.
Let her night turn to day,
Her spirit soar away.
